Attenutin™: New Pre-Clinical Study on HMGB1 & Lung Inflammation

In a new published pre-clinical study1 (Sept 2023), Attenutin™ was evaluated for its efficacy in attenuating acute inflammatory lung injury and sepsis with results strongly suggesting that Attenutin™ could be indicated for oxidative-stress-induced lung damage protection, possibly through attenuation of increased extracellular HMGB1 accumulation.

Reducing the level of extracellular HMGB1 induced by oxidative stress and/or respiratory tract infection may have a significant impact on protecting the lungs from injury and preserving normal physiological respiratory tract functions.

HMGB1 is among the key inflammatory mediators up regulated at the time of chronic exposure to pollution. Extracellular HMGB1 accumulation in the airways and the lung plays a significant role in the pathogenesis of inflammatory lung injury.
